'From Squeak3.7 of ''4 September 2004'' [latest update: #5989] on 21 December 2004 at 11:17:52 pm'! !ObjectScanner new initialize! !self smartRefStream!class structure  DictionaryN  AssociationObject?TranslucentColorrgb cachedDepthcachedBitPatternalpha? BorderStyle?QStatefsm stateName? tallyarray?Pointxy? TableLayout propertiesminExtentCache?IdentityDictionary   ?RunArrayrunsvalues lastIndexlastRun lastOffset?Number?OrGateboundsowner submorphs fullBoundscolor extension borderWidth borderColorverticesclosed filledFormarrows arrowForms smoothCurve curveStateborderDashSpechandles borderFormstateinputsCollectionoutputsCollectioninputsReportingverts?AndGate    * 6 = H U b l t            ? TextAttribute?String?LargePositiveInteger?QHsmMorphicEventHandler myStatemySourcemorphhandlershandledeventfirstClickDown eventQueue idleHistory? DisplayObject? InfiniteForm patternForm?MorphExtension lockedvisiblesticky balloonTextballoonTextSelector externalName isPartsDonor actorStateplayer eventHandlerotherProperties? NCLabelMorph    * 6 = constrained constraint dieWithInputinputs lastTargetstepTimelastTargetBoundsoffsetlabel? TextMorph    * 6 = H U textStyletextwrapFlag paragrapheditor container predecessor successorbackgroundColormargins?RectangleMorph     * 6 = H U? BorderedMorph     * 6 = H U?NCCurvecontoursboundsscaleoffset? TextStyle  fontArrayfontFamilySizelineGridbaseline alignment firstIndent restIndent rightIndent tabsArraymarginTabsArrayleadingdefaultFontIndex?NCGrabbableDisplayTextMorph    * 6 = H U Q \ b l w      acceptOnCRacceptOnFocusLoss? LogicWire     * 6 = eventHandler constraintsline graphModelorGate? StrikeFontcharacterToGlyphMapxTableglyphsnametypeminAsciimaxAsciimaxWidth strikeLengthascentdescentxOffsetraster subscript superscriptemphasisderivativeFonts pointSize? LookupKeykey?ArrayedCollection?NCConstraintMorph    * 6 =       ? Rectangleorigincorner?Textstringruns? LineSegmentstartend?QHsm  )? Magnitude? Collection? InputGate    * 6 = H U b l t            ?Integer?Set   ? LayoutPolicy?NCAAEventHandler   ) 3 : D M T d p?TableLayoutProperties hResizing vResizing disableLayout cellInsetcellPositioning cellSpacing layoutInset listCentering listDirection listSpacingreverseTableCellsrubberBandCells wrapCentering wrapDirection minCellSize maxCellSize?Float?Color ? SharedQueue contentsArray readPosition writePosition accessProtect readSynch?Morph    * 6 =?NCOffsetConstraintMorph    * 6 =        ? PasteUpMorph    * 6 = H U presentermodelcursorpaddingbackgroundMorphturtleTrailsForm turtlePenlastTurtlePositions isPartsBinautoLineLayoutindicateCursor resizeToFitwantsMouseOverHalos worldState griddingOn?Bitmap?Symbol?Inverter    * 6 = H U b l t            ?LayoutProperties ? CircleMorph     * 6 = H U? EllipseMorph     * 6 = H U? MessageSendreceiverselector arguments? DisplayMedium? AbstractFont? PolygonMorph    * 6 = H U b l t       ? NCLineMorph    * 6 = H U lineWidth fillStyle smoothCurveverticessegmentscontoursarrows arrowForms arrowScales arrowJoints?WeakSet   flag?SequenceableCollection?TextFontChange fontNumber? LogicGate    * 6 = H U b l t            ? DiskProxyglobalObjectName preSelectorconstructorSelectorconstructorArgs? SimpleBorder baseColorcolorwidth?Formbitswidthheightdepthoffset? QHsmMorph    * 6 = ?NCAAConnectorMorph     * 6 =  - 3?NCDisplayTextMorph    * 6 = H U Q \ b l w       ?NCLineEndConstraintMorph    * 6 =        firstVertexlineAttachmentPoint? WeakArray?OrderedCollectionarray firstIndex lastIndex? ProtoObject?NCLineArrowGlyph b l t {originalFirstContour?Array? NCTextMorph    * 6 = H U Q \ b l w       ? ? ;value superclasses N? L ? h ? L? 7? L?  L? 7 Y? o ?  H?  _?  ?  ?  L?  H?  ?  A?  L?  ?  L? r ?  ?  ?  i? O L?  L? ; ?  S? N ? & _? H `? i i? L? H?  L? A L? _ L? y L? ?  ? 7 y? Y L? u ? ? ? L?  L? i L?  i?  ?  H? 7 ? M ?  L?  L? L ?  L?  ?  L?  ?  ? 9 7? ` y?  ?   ? A L?  ?  ?  i? S ?  ? 2 i?  }?  `? nil? 1 O? } H?  ? ? & 0#1O ?  q= 2@  ?  o?preferredConnectionconnectToNearestPointToCenter? fillStyle ?@ 19  9    44 @}@n`@}@s@ @}@s@@@s@@}@n`@}@s0@@s0@@s0@@s0@@s@@@s@@@sP@@sP@@sP@}@sP@}@n`@}@n`@}@n`@}@n`@}@n`@}@n`@}@n`1 T o? a  ??@4@4 ! ! ! ! ! ! ! ! ! ! !1 !h !? !u ! ??@4@4 ! ! ! ! ! ! ! ! ! ! ! !  3@}@n`@@s@ )nearestPointToCenterOf: 0    o?connectedConstraints9L # ) # # # #? borderStyle   #none  P 9 #- o? #    $*  # +!!?  #- o? #e92/ A9  9 ? o? v ?  ?  %x " %*4@f+!!?L &+ &+29 AC Y ? o? v ?  ?Q9 1C Y &I   >> @|@s@@s@|@s@@s@@s@@s@@s@@s@@s@@s@@s@|@s@|@s@|@s@|@s@|@s@|@s@|@s1 ( (? ( ( ??  ! ! !" !0 !> !L1 )^ )y? )k ) ?? ! ! " "$ "2 "@ "N "\ = =@|@s@@s &9 " % %*>@f+!!?2 ,!A6 X ? o? v ?  ? (!5 X *   1- @x@s@@r@u1&y@s&x@1&y@r&x@1&y@r&x@1&y@r&x@@r@@r@@r+@@r+@@r+@z@s+@z@s+@z@s+@x@s@x@s@u1&y@s&x@u1&y@s&x1 -J -e? -W - ??  ! ! !" !0 !> !L1 . .? . .8 ?? ! ! " "$ "2 "@ "N "\ 0 ,@x@s@@r * " % %*1@u#-m? * &+? # # #@r$@r@q@MR i}@r@q@}߅e@sؑh@ӍG@s[@}߅e@sbp(@MR i}@s'`nʏ@r$@s'`nʏ $* P &I #- o? # $ $ $ $ $ $*  A3I  #- o? #e92A9C Y &I ? o? v ?  ? & 10 " #  0>A3IL 1 1 1 1 1? # # #44HH $*   0_  %* $_ P * #- o? # $ $ $ $ $ $*  %* !".  #- o? #e92!A(!2 X * ? o? v ?  ? +7 4 " % 3-@cZ~-F!".L 4 4 42!A!! Y# ? o? v ?  ? ! Y# 4    @x@q@@q@z@qq&x@@q&x@@q&x@@q&x@@q@@q@1&y@q+@1&y@q+@1&y@q+@u1&y@q+@u1&y@q+@u1&y@q+@x@q@x@q@z@qq&x@z@qq&x1 73 7N? 7@ 7i ??  ! ! !" !0 !> !L1 7 8? 7 8! ?? ! ! " "$ "2 "@ "N "\  @x@q@@q 4 " % 3@i9%Һ 4 4? # #?attachmentPointSpecs firstVertexpointAtOffset:?zG{?zoM lastVertex 9?θQ? !d, 9?(\)?zoM8 9?(\)?zoM # @ "_@q8V@%8@q8V@QǴ+@r rL@YM>`@rQ`lv@QǴ+@rt?34@%8@rg@ "_@rg@ꇹU%Q@rt?34@8@rQ`lv@ꇹU%Q@r rL $*  3P 4 ?  o? # $ $ $ $ $ $*  !  ;q o? #e92 1" Z ? o? v ?  ? !" Z  >? > > ??  ! ! !" !0 !> !L1 ?d ?? ?q ? ?? ! ! " "$ "2 "@ "N "\  @P@q@@q !L1 D D? D D ?? ! ! " "$ "2 "@ "N "\    @|@p@@p A " % ; @f @ A A A? # # #@|p@p$eL@E3W:̠@p$eL@uL@qh`@ %|@qK\k@uL@qpyX@E3W:̠@q@S$@|p@q@S$ $* P !L1 L L? L L ?? ! ! " "$ "2 "@ "N "\  @}@q@~0@q I| " % G@f!a( H H? # #?hasHalo #@~10,@q¡a@~xzj@q¡a@~xzj@rxܵ :@Vg@q¡a@~xzj@q\L@~xzj@q¡a $*P I #- o? # $ $ $ $ $ $*  $_  G  G$  ;P A ;q o? # $ $ $ $ $ $*  @  ;q o? #e9L P P2A W A ? o? v ?  ? A Q " % P @ P P P? # # # $*   P$  ;  ;_  3  N@V0 %x h o? #e9L TBr ! ?; ! TK  o?layoutProperties spaceFillrigid  A NfamilyName:size:emphasized:Accuny  A TextConstantsat:DefaultTabsArrayA U= UMDefaultMarginTabsArray f S o? layoutPolicy7  shrinkWrap V'center $*topLeft topToBottom $* VP $*?? T V# K  T` TB2A# Za I ? o? v ?  ? I V " %  J   TB TB?triggeredWireFinishU u W Connected  ) %x  $_  a  Q A A S o? W u XN W W Q A A P$ P  a$"9  * 4 +7 S o? WP u X W X * 4 +7 3  a"$  @ 4 5  S o? WR u Y W Y# @ 4 5  ;_ 3 5 qG  10 &9 & S o? W u Z$ W Y 10 &9 & 0_ 0 '  V I| I S o? W u Z W Za V I| I N #  a&  H $* VP leftToRight $* VP VY?? # )N ) `!